Police have raided at least five homes as part of the shooting of Rakayia Dawson in Rangeville in the early hours of Wednesday morning.

Dawson has undergone surgery and had part of his bowel removed after allegedly being shot in the stomach and knee.

As part of the raids a number of people were taken into custody and interviewed by police.  Two of the men who were in police custody yesterday had not been charged by end of the day.

Police have however, charged 23-year-old Jackson Paul Edward McInnes with attempted murder.

McInnes appeared in a Toowoomba Court yesterday, the case was adjourned until September 14th.

The motive behind the shooting remains unknown.

While police are still searching for a second offender they are asking for anyone with information about the incident to please come forward.
